Across TCGA patient cohorts, PLA2G4A protein abundance is significantly associated with the RNA expression of many other genes, with 14,772 significant associations in total. BRCA shows the largest number of these associations.

The most reproducible PLA2G4A-associated genes across cancer lineages are PACERR, PTGS2, and FAM89A. Each is linked with PLA2G4A in more than 7 cancer types. Because this analysis shows association rather than direction, both PLA2G4A-to-partner and partner-to-PLA2G4A results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, PLA2G4A versus PACERR in LUAD, with a Pearson correlation of 0.63.
